Output 50907d3a20916482bb70fd48198348572f2f0fd082ba31e59e751d2a99539001:2

value
1468266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a41b58c7f0ac3c647cceecd96668316a52670600 OP_EQUAL
address
3GejW6M2QbaqkhNCpxWrKKo2KcX99gXXxJ
transaction
50907d3a20916482bb70fd48198348572f2f0fd082ba31e59e751d2a99539001
spent
true